List of Victims of Nazism

This is a list of victims of Nazism who were noted for their achievements.

This list includes people from public life who, owing to their origins, their political or religious convictions, or their sexual orientation, lost their lives as a result of Nazism. This list includes those whose deaths were part of the Holocaust as well as individuals who died in other ways at the hands of the Nazis during World War II. People who died in concentration camps are listed alongside those who were murdered by the Nazi Party or those who chose suicide for political motives or to avoid being murdered.

This list is sorted by occupation and by nationality.
